Young hero Daggubati Rana’ who debuted in Tollywood with the Leader movie is also debuting into Bollywood with the movie titled "Dum Maro Dum", which is being directed by Rohan Sippy. Apart from this movie Rana is laso acting in his second film "Nenu Naa Rakshasi" under Puri Jagannadh direction with Ileana in the female lead role.
Rana is playing the role of Goan rock musician (Joki) in Dum Maro Dum and Rana wants to get rid of his Hyderabadi accent and learn Goan Hindi to fit into the role.
The story line of this movie is, it revolves around the lives of six Indians who meet in Goa, and how their lives change forever once involved in drug mafias. The film starring Abhishek Bachchan, Bipasha Basu and Prateik Babbar is releasing on April 22.
Rana said that "I had to get rid of my Hyderabadi Hindi and learn Goan Hindi. It wasn’t easy because the two kinds of Hindis were mutually incompatible. I had to unlearn one kind of Hindi and then learn a new kind. Since I was brought up in Chennai, I speak fluent Tamil and Telugu. I am confused about which language to sing in,"
Now Rana is very busy on travelling between Mumbai to Hyderabad, because he is going to Mumbai to promote Dum Maaro Dum and then rushing back to Hyderabad for his new Telugu film Nenu Na Rakshasi, which will hit the screens soon.
